Like many municipalities in the department, Sigonce had a school well before the Jules Ferry laws: in 1863, they already had a primary education that provides boys, the chief town. The same instruction was given to girls, although the Falloux law (1851), which required the opening of a girls' school in municipalities had more than 800 unsupported inhabitants., (p) The town benefits from the subsidies of the second Duruy Act (1877) to build a new school.

The coup of
December 2, 1851 by Napoleon III committed against the Second Republic of France provoked an armed uprising in the Basses-Alpes, in defense of the French Constitution of 1848. After the failure of the uprising, severe repression continued for those who stood up to defend the Republic: new

In ancient times the territory of
Sigonce was part of the Sogiontiques, whose territory extends south of the Baronnies à la Durance. The Sogiontiques are federated to Voconces and after the Roman conquest, they were attached with them in the Roman province of Narbonne. In the second century, they

While the southeast of Gaul was a land
Burgundian under King of the Ostrogoths, Theodoric the Great conquered the region between Durance, Rhone and Isere in 510. The town briefly depended once more on Italy until 526. To reconcile with the Burgundian king, Gondemar III, the regent Ostrogothic
